Output d3624edb2c8c53e65185641ec409462cd86ada9383e1a530c1b37d6f3e229319:7

value
786867149
script pubkey
OP_0 OP_PUSHBYTES_32 8fcf27bac65f7d4d73a41da93e02b8cf3fe1962ea9418b40b0fc9590ea21f124
address
bc1q3l8j0wkxta756uayrk5nuq4ceul7r93w49qcks9slj2ep63p7yjqz5amk6
transaction
d3624edb2c8c53e65185641ec409462cd86ada9383e1a530c1b37d6f3e229319
spent
true